PHF accounts detail to be put on website: Asif
ISLAMABAD: Pakistan Hockey Federation (PHF) secretary Muhammad Asif Bajwa got vote of confidence from executive board and has immediately decided to publish PHF accounts detail on the website after every three months.
PHF President Brig (r) Khalid Sajjad Khokhar presided over the board meeting on Monday, which was attended by the secretaries of hockey associations of all four provinces, PHF vice presidents and general manager women wing.
Asif Bajwa’s name was proposed by Zahir Shah, KP Hockey president, and was backed by Sindh Hockey Association.
“I would take along all the provinces in an effort to restructure hockey in the country. Today is the new beginning in Pakistan hockey where the respect for every stakeholder of the game would be the key word,” Asif Bajwa said after getting vote of confidence.
He said after getting approval from the house he had decided to publish entire earning and expenditures of the federation on PHF website after every three months. “Soon we would host the National Hockey Championship with venue to be decided in ten days time.”
Asif Bajwa said that he was not responsible of any misappropriation of funds in the past as he was not a part of PHF during the last four years. “Whosoever has done anything wrong should be responsible for his deeds. Forensic audit is already underway. Guilty will have to face the music.”
He said that for the restoration of the game all provinces will have to work together. The board and PHF president have decided that details of the federation accounts will be issued on the PHF website quarterly, definitely.
“The PHF has made a big mistake when it decided to stay out of FIH Pro League as it led to a heavy fine. We will see how the matter can be resolved. I would talk to the FIH president Narinder Batra in this regard,” the secretary said.
